Formworks have revolutionized the way construction companies approach the design and erection of concrete structures, particularly columns. These integral components are vital for providing structural support and stability in buildings, bridges, and various infrastructural projects. As the construction industry continues to evolve, the importance of efficient and effective formwork systems cannot be overstated.


Formwork refers to the temporary or permanent molds used to hold liquid concrete in place until it cures and gains sufficient strength to support itself. For column construction, specialized formwork systems have been developed to allow for faster assembly, precise shaping, and improved overall durability. Column formworks come in various types, each designed to meet specific building requirements and project constraints.

Insulated Concrete Forms (ICFs) have also gained popularity in recent years. These forms not only provide the necessary support during the curing process but also offer excellent thermal insulation properties once the concrete sets. This dual benefit makes ICFs appealing for companies focused on energy efficiency and sustainability in construction.

The introduction of modular formwork systems has further optimized the construction process. These systems are prefabricated off-site and can be assembled quickly on-site, reducing labor costs and minimizing delays. The adaptability of modular systems allows for them to be suited for various project sizes and types, making them a versatile choice for column construction.


In addition to the physical materials and systems used, the technological advancement in formwork has played a significant role in enhancing productivity. Companies are increasingly leveraging Building Information Modeling (BIM) technology to develop detailed 3D models of their projects. This allows construction teams to visualize the placement and specifications of formwork, streamlining the planning and execution phases. Moreover, integrating technology into the formwork process helps identify potential issues before they arise, saving both time and resources.


Another critical aspect of column formwork systems is safety. With high-rise buildings and complex structures becoming more common, ensuring the safety of workers during construction is paramount. Modern formwork solutions often incorporate safety features such as guardrails and fall protection systems. Training workers on proper formwork handling techniques and safety protocols is equally important, fostering a culture of safety on the job site.


As society increasingly emphasizes sustainability, column companies are also focusing on eco-friendly practices. This includes using materials with lower environmental impacts, optimizing the use of resources, and minimizing waste during the construction process. Some companies are even exploring the use of recycled materials for formwork, further contributing to green building initiatives.
